From 0e364b89b1d0fba406c1426960a10c279d140ffa Mon Sep 17 00:00:00 2001 From: jl777 Date: Tue, 6 Nov 2018 23:32:50 -1100 Subject: [PATCH] Use vout2 for refund --- src/cc/dice.cpp | 1 + 1 file changed, 1 insertion(+) diff --git a/src/cc/dice.cpp b/src/cc/dice.cpp index 2f48330c4..e57accbae 100644 --- a/src/cc/dice.cpp +++ b/src/cc/dice.cpp @@ -1157,6 +1157,7 @@ std::string DiceBetFinish(uint8_t &funcid,uint256 &entropyused,int32_t *resultp, mtx.vin.push_back(CTxIn(bettxid,1,CScript())); funcid = 'R'; mtx.vout.push_back(CTxOut(betTx.vout[0].nValue,fundingPubKey)); + mtx.vout.push_back(CTxOut(txfee,fundingPubKey)); mtx.vout.push_back(CTxOut(betTx.vout[1].nValue,betTx.vout[2].scriptPubKey)); *resultp = 1; return(FinalizeCCTx(0,cp,mtx,fundingpk,txfee,EncodeDiceOpRet(funcid,sbits,fundingtxid,entropyused,oldbettxid))); // need to change opreturn to include oldbetTx to allow validation